Autism spectrum disorder (ASD) is a neurodevelopmental condition marked by persistent deficits in social communication and interaction alongside restrictive and repetitive behaviors or interests. ASD is sometimes accompanied by intellectual impairment.
These core symptoms manifest differently among individuals, ranging from mild to severe. The disorder's complexity extends beyond its clinical presentation, encompassing a diverse range of biological, cognitive, and sociocultural influences.

Modeling, a key technique in therapy, uses observational learning to help clients acquire and practice new skills by watching therapists demonstrate desired behaviors. This approach, rooted in Albert Bandura's concept of vicarious learning, plays a significant role in therapeutic interventions for various psychological conditions, including social anxiety, ADHD, and depression.

A Statistical Physics Perspective to Understand Social Visual Attention in Autism Spectrum Disorder.

Children with Autism Spectrum Disorder (ASD) exhibit distinct visual attention patterns compared to typically developing (TD) children. Their gaze movements show greater dispersion, indicating differences in social visual attention.

Area of Science:

  • Neuroscience
  • Developmental Psychology
  • Computational Biology

Background:

  • Social visual attention is crucial for development.
  • Autism Spectrum Disorder (ASD) is associated with altered social interaction and attention.
  • Brockmann and Geisel's model provides a framework for analyzing visual attention patterns.

Purpose of the Study:

  • To investigate social visual attention differences in children with ASD versus typically developing (TD) children.
  • To analyze gaze movement patterns using eye-tracking technology and computational modeling.
  • To compare the distribution and clustering of gaze points between ASD and TD groups.

Main Methods:

  • Utilized eye-tracking technology to record gaze movements during free visual exploration.
  • Applied data-driven analysis of eye movement distribution, avoiding experimenter bias.
  • Employed a computational model to simulate and analyze group differences in visual attention.

Main Results:

  • Scanpaths of both TD and ASD children exhibited characteristics of Lévy flights.
  • Children with ASD demonstrated a higher frequency of long saccadic amplitudes.
  • Clustering analysis revealed greater dispersion of eye movements in children with ASD.
  • Computational modeling indicated higher dispersion parameters for the ASD group.

Conclusions:

  • Children with ASD display a greater dispersion of gaze points compared to TD children.
  • These findings suggest unique visual attention strategies in ASD.
  • The study highlights the utility of computational models in understanding neurodevelopmental differences.
